Curriculum Map Unit Review Process Protocol for Vertical Articulation

Purpose

• Better understand the vertical curriculum

• Check standards alignment

• Examine skills for gaps/redundancies

• Raise questions to be considered/addressed

Protocol

Be non-judgmental – You are not critiquing individual maps.

1. Appoint a facilitator to keep the group on task and discourage debate, a timekeeper, and a

recorder. The purpose of this process is to identify the questions and areas that need to be

discussed using a protocol where all voices are heard.

2. Use the comparative unit calendar directions below to compare units on your device. Begin

with red reading unit first.

3. Each teacher reads the units silently, without discussion.

4. Record your thoughts in each area: Ah Hah’s, standards alignment, skills alignment (gaps

and redundancies) and questions/comments. (5-7 minutes)

5. Go around the table with each team member speaking: first ah-hah’s, then standards

alignment, skills gaps/ redundancies, questions/comments. Recorder will document during

the sharing session on one electronic 4-square document. Each team member shares without

discussion. (1-2 minutes per team member.)

6. After each person has shared, team discusses trends and/or patterns noted and implications

for possible revisions. (5-7 minutes)

7. Use the same process for the green writing units.

8. Each team will share 3-4 key points from the reading unit and 3-4 key points from the

writing unit. (post on chart paper.)

Comparative Unit Calendar

To review 2 or more units side by side, use the comparative unit calendar in the Reports tab.

• Comparative Unit Calendar

• Select subject and grade levels

• Browse

• Check appropriate courses then close

• Submit

• Select the unit for each grade level/course

• Compare units
